@Marvin my git pull step is not working:
Copy code
pull:
  - prefect.deployments.steps.git_clone:
      repository: <https://github.com/account/repo_name.git>
      credentials: "{{ prefect.blocks.github-credentials.github-pat }}"
I get :
Copy code
raise RuntimeError(
RuntimeError: Failed to clone repository '<https://github.com/account/repo_name.git>' with exit code 128.
But not when the repo is public, but the credentials are there so it should work when it's private as well

The error you're encountering, "Failed to clone repository with exit code 128," often indicates an issue with authentication or connectivity when accessing a private repository. In the context of Prefect, it's important to ensure that the credentials block is properly configured. Here are a few things to check: 1. Credentials Format: Make sure that your GitHub Personal Access Token (PAT) is correctly formatted and has the necessary permissions to access the private repository. 2. Credentials Block: Verify that the credentials block is correctly set up in Prefect. It should be something like
{{ prefect.blocks.github-credentials.github-pat }}
and should match the block you've configured with your PAT. 3. Repository URL: Double-check the repository URL. It should not include angle brackets (
< >
). Ensure it's correctly specified as
<https://github.com/account/repo_name.git>
. 4. Network Access: Ensure that the network where the Prefect agent or worker is running has access to the internet and can reach GitHub. If these checks don't resolve the issue, consider reviewing any specific configurations or logs that might provide more insights.
